Sir Bruce Forsyth to host and interview Liza Minnelli at the London Palladium

By 
Two titans of entertainment will collide in a one-off special event at the London Palladium later this year.

Sir Bruce Forsyth will host and interview his close friend and US showbiz icon Liza Minnelli on Sunday, September 20.

Minnelli previously sang 'New York, New York' to Forsyth on his 80th birthday show on the BBC in 2008, and they will now reunite for An Evening with Liza Minnelli.

Forsyth said: "I am absolutely delighted to be spending an evening in the company of one of the truly great entertainers of our age, someone I am also lucky to know as a dear friend.

"I am looking forward to guiding her on a trip down memory lane on the stage of the greatest theatre in the world - The London Palladium, where both of us have been lucky enough to perform in many times over the years.

"She's got some great stories to tell, and I'm sure it's going to be a truly unforgettable evening."

Minnelli said of Sir Bruce: "He's a marvellous, wonderful man who I consider my buddy and who I just love.

"I'm always so excited to return to Britain, which I've considered to be a second home for many years. I have so many friends there and I look forward to being back again for these special intimate evenings.

"Whenever I do concerts people always say they want to hear about me growing up, being on Broadway, in the movies, the people I've met and worked with… so this will give me a chance to share a lot more of those stories. I can't wait to see you all again!"

The Cabaret star will also perform An Intimate Evening with Liza Minnelli in Sheffield at the City Hall on Tuesday, September 22 and at the Clyde Auditorium, Glasgow on Thursday, September 24.
